Output 8f5b1dd7424c3068d0bb1bc41ed76d78ea8c604209fb83eeeb25299c8c628a43:2

value
10605570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6168bb06b0ff62724272a142cf4d2aa19fa96b OP_EQUAL
address
3QWuYc1wFue12Uaff6MpsCZ6bjU9mrTz37
transaction
8f5b1dd7424c3068d0bb1bc41ed76d78ea8c604209fb83eeeb25299c8c628a43
spent
true